A masterful, "seductive" debut novel about fate, family secrets, and the stories our bodies tell (NYTBR).

Magdalena has an unsettling gift. She sees the truth about people written on their skin—names, dates, details both banal and profound—and her only relief from the onslaught of information is to take off her glasses and let the world recede. Mercifully, her own skin is blank.
When she meets Neil, she is intrigued to see her name on his cheek, and she is drawn into a family drama that began more than half a century before, when Neil's father, Richard, was abandoned at birth by his mother, a famous expatriate novelist. As secrets are revealed among forgotten texts in the archives of Paris, on a dusty cattle ranch in the American West, along ancient pilgrim paths, and in a run-down apartment in post-Soviet Lithuania, the novel's unforgettable characters converge—by chance, or perhaps by fate—and Magdalena's uncanny ability may be the key to their happiness.

        Starred review from January 1, 2017

        Sixtysomething Richard Beart wants to solve the mystery of his dead mother's abandonment of him when he was an infant. He starts his search through French hospital records with only a memory fragment of a red pair of shoes worn by Inga Beart, an international literary sensation whose 1954 act of self-harm horrified the world. In tandem with his own quest, Richard sends his son, Neil, a student in England, on a delivery mission that takes him to Lithuania, France, and Paris. Neil is constantly sidetracked by his own half-recollection of a disturbing moment in his father's teaching career that cost Richard his job. Magdalena, whose mother is the designated recipient of Richard's gifts to be delivered by Neil, literally sees the histories and memories of everyone around her. Word fragments appear all over their bodies whenever she wears her glasses. The lives of Magdalena and the Bearts intersect, separate, and circle ever closer, triggering a hunt across several European countries in search of answers. VERDICT Hypnotically peculiar, exquisitely plotted, and teeming with suspense, Saunders's brilliant debut pulls at plot threads as delicate as gossamer silk to get at the truth and the destiny of her flawed, appealing, maddening characters.--Beth Andersen, formerly with Ann Arbor Dist.
